Increase your Networth like Dangote: The power of execution

Aliko Dangote, Africa’s richest man, has demonstrated the transformative power of execution through his $20 billion Dangote Refinery project. Over 11 years of development, Dangote’s unwavering determination saw him overcome delays, financial hurdles, and regulatory challenges, resulting in the completion of the world’s largest single-train refinery.

The impact is undeniable. With a capacity to refine 650,000 barrels of oil daily, the refinery aims to make Nigeria self-sufficient in fuel, significantly reducing fuel imports and conserving foreign exchange. This achievement has single-handedly doubled Dangote’s wealth to $28 billion in 2024, showcasing the rewards of focused execution and long-term vision.
